Run through the small, narrow Eichholzwäldli, contrary to the Komoot card, two parallel trails (see photo with map section). One in the middle of the forest and one, just a few meters away, along the western edge of the forest.
The trail at the edge of the forest is narrow, curvy in places between trees and also includes roots, root stages and two forkings.
The other trail is much wider with simple root passages and leads almost straight through the forest.
Since the Eichholzwäldli lies on a slope that slopes from north to south, the more technically demanding trail (Cat. S1-S2) is recommended for downhill and the easier trail (Cat. S1) for uphill.
Of course it's also the other way round 😉
Be careful at the crossroads with the gravel roads. Depending on the vegetation, these are very confusing.
The Eichholzwäldli is also a popular local recreation area.
So you always have to count on pedestrians, children playing, cyclists, dogs, etc.
